Children may get sedation if they're terrified of going to the dentist or refuse to cooperate during the visit.

Nitrous oxide tends to be safe in children, and just about any dentist can use it.

Some pediatric dentists are trained to give children oral sedation. It can be safe when kept within the recommended dose for the child's age and weight.
